**Black History Month Spotlight: Dr. Ann Als, Trailblazing Physician**
Albany Medical College is honoring Dr. Ann Als during Black History Month as a pioneer in the field of medicine. Dr. Als was the first Black female graduate of Albany Medical College, earning her degree in 1970. Her journey was remarkable—she began her pre-medical studies at the age of 25 while balancing responsibilities as a married mother. Reflecting on her path, Dr. Als once stated, “My contention was, it’s never too late to do something you want to do. You have only one life.”
Following her graduation, Dr. Als completed her residency at Albany Hospital. Her career included practicing medicine at Beth Israel Hospital, serving as a teacher at Harvard Medical School, and leading research protocols for major pharmaceutical companies. Dr. Als’ accomplishments paved the way for future generations, inspiring others to pursue their goals regardless of the challenges they face.
Dr. Als’ legacy lives on through her family as well—her daughter, Joanne, followed in her footsteps, graduating from Albany Medical College in 1986. Dr. Als’ story remains a testament to perseverance and breaking barriers in medicine.
